Nick Marshall runs through the Brick Quarters housing area as part of the 2023 Air Force Marathon on Wright-Patterson Air Force Base, Ohio, Sept. 16, 2023. Races in several distance categories are held during Air Force Marathon weekend, including the 26.2-mile full marathon, half-marathon, 10K, 5K and Tailwind Trot 1K Kids Run. Brandon Hough crosses the finish line in 35 minutes, 20 seconds to win the men's 10K in the Air Force Marathon's first race Sept. 17. The 10K took place as part of the 26th annual Air Force Marathon events at the National Museum of the U.S. Air Force at Wright-Patterson Air Force Base, Ohio.

Paralympic gold medalist Grace Norman-Taylor wins the Air Force Marathon's female 10K division with a time of 39 minutes, 57 seconds. Norman was among thousands of runners in the 26th annual Air Force Marathon on Sept. 17 at Wright-Patterson Air Force Base, Ohio.

Medals for the 2022 Air Force Marathon hang on display at the race’s finish line at Wright-Patterson Air Force Base, Ohio, Sept. 17, 2022. More than 8,500 runners and 1,500 volunteers from all 50 states and 18 different countries came out to run in the race’s 26th year. (U.S. Air Force photo by Jaima Fogg)
